Removal of matter from register
Subregulation 1
Before removing from the register any matter which appears to the Registrar to have ceased to have effect, the Registrar —
may, if he considers it appropriate, publish his intention to remove that matter; and
shall send notice of such intention to any person who appears to him to be likely to be affected by the removal.
Subregulation 2
Within 2 months after the date on which his intention to remove the matter is published under paragraph (1)(a), any person may file with the Registrar a notice of opposition to the removal in Form TM 11.
Subregulation 3
Within 2 months after the date on which notice of his intention to remove the matter is sent to any person under paragraph (1)(b), that person may file with the Registrar a notice of opposition to the removal in Form TM 11.
Subregulation 4
If the Registrar is satisfied after considering any opposition to the removal that the matter has not ceased to have effect, he shall not remove it.
Subregulation 5
Where there has been no response to the Registrar’s publication or notice, he may remove the matter.
Subregulation 6
If the Registrar is satisfied after considering any opposition to the removal that the entry or any part thereof has ceased to have effect, he shall remove the entry or that part of the entry, as the case may be.
